Ineffective Aid U.S. Agency for International Development official Nancy Lindborg says the Sahel region of Africa is in the midst of long-term drought and the agency has provided $350 million this year to aid the area. Meanwhile, the Center for Global Development has issued an assessment of the quality of aid given by donors to the agriculture sector in poor countries. The first hurdle in the effort was apparently poor or unavailable data.Although donor pledges for agricultural assistance doubled to over $8 billion in 2010, just 5.1 percent of Official Development Assistance goes to agriculture (4.6 percent for the U.S.); nearly 60 percent of aid goes to social services and economic infrastructure.
